The Feasibility Studies Grant is offering to support enterprises in exploring and validating new business ideas to determine their viability and sustainability.
The focus areas of the program include feasibility assessment of business ideas, research and innovation development, promotion of entrepreneurship, economic exploitation of new ideas, strengthening research and innovation capacities, fostering creativity and innovation, and supporting key sectors such as health and well-being, sustainable resource use for climate change mitigation and adaptation, smart manufacturing, marine and maritime technology, aviation and aerospace, and future digital technologies.
This scheme is designed to help enterprises conduct feasibility studies that enable informed decision-making about new business ideas or expansions. The studies are expected to help businesses evaluate potential success, identify required resources, and determine sustainability before moving forward with implementation.
The initiative supports investment in research, development, and innovation as a means to drive economic growth and strengthen Malta’s innovation ecosystem. It aligns with broader objectives to enhance competitiveness and promote smart economic transformation through innovation and advanced technologies.
The scheme will remain active until 31 December 2026, subject to the availability of funds. The total allocated budget is €2,000,000. The maximum grant available per undertaking is €100,000, and the total funding received across multiple approved applications cannot exceed this limit.
Eligibility is open to micro, small, medium-sized, and small mid-cap enterprises engaged in economic activities, regardless of their legal form. Applicants must comply with legal registration requirements, including those applicable to entities without legal personality.
